Latest Patents

Natsuka’s recent patents focus on the cloning and application of a gene that encodes for murine leukocyte α(1,3) fucosyltransferase. This enzyme is notable for its ability to synthesize the sialyl Lewis x determinant. His patent details include:

- Murine α(1,3) fucosyltransferase Fuc-TVII, DNA encoding the same, method for preparing the same, antibodies recognizing the same, immunoassays for detecting the same, plasmids containing such DNA, and cells containing such a plasmid.

This work contributes significantly to immunological research and has potential applications in therapeutic development.
